Training prog for Hajj pilgrims held at Doda

Doda, May 02: District Administration Doda on Tuesday organised a day-long training programme for the selected Hajj pilgrims about Manasik-e-Haj at Astan Masjid Sharif Doda. More than 172 pilgrims attended the training session at Doda and total of 375 pilgrims were imparted training across Doda.
The Hajjis were imparted practical training and information in detail about the Hajj rituals as well as logistic support. The trainers gave thorough information to the pilgrims with regard to boarding, lodging, accommodation, currency exchange and other activities to be performed during the pilgrimage. They were also briefed about important documents and luggage to be carried along.
Meanwhile, the Hajj pilgrims expressed gratitude to the Deputy Commissioner, Vishesh Paul Mahajan for the cooperation and effective management to ensure a smooth pilgrimage for them.
